Transaction 3954437336fb59bc86cdae6c02bf41f0bc340710c4688311309c4355581d1020
1 Input
1 Output
-
3954437336fb59bc86cdae6c02bf41f0bc340710c4688311309c4355581d1020:0
- value
- 19515
- script pubkey
- OP_0 OP_PUSHBYTES_20 181101133c66d8d93cfb7bb81057eb66f513e0ed
- address
- bc1qrqgszyeuvmvdj08m0wupq4ltvm638c8dde72ep